The foundation of ultra pose skeleton lies in deep learning, specifically convolutional neural networks trained on vast datasets of annotated images. Unlike traditional pose estimation methods, this approach can infer the location of key joints even when they are partially obscured. The system processes visual input in real-time, creating a topological map that connects body parts with skeletal lines. This intricate network of data points generates a dynamic 3D model of the subject, translating visual information into actionable spatial coordinates that computers can interpret.

At its core, the technology relies on keypoint detection, identifying specific anatomical locations such as shoulders, elbows, and knees with remarkable precision. The "ultra" designation signifies the density of these keypoints, often numbering in the dozens, providing a granular understanding of body configuration. This high-resolution mapping allows for the analysis of micro-movements and joint angles, which is critical for applications in biomechanics and rehabilitation. The system's ability to maintain accuracy across varying lighting conditions and complex backgrounds makes it exceptionally robust for real-world deployment.

In the health and fitness sector, ultra pose skeleton technology is revolutionizing how we monitor physical activity and prevent injury. Trainers can use this data to correct a client's form during weightlifting or yoga, ensuring optimal alignment and reducing the risk of strain. Physical therapists leverage the detailed movement tracking to assess recovery progress after surgery or injury, creating personalized rehabilitation plans based on objective metrics. The system can flag dangerous postures or asymmetrical movements that might lead to chronic pain, acting as a proactive safeguard for long-term physical health.

Enhancing Athletic Performance

For athletes, the insights provided by ultra pose skeleton analysis are invaluable. Coaches can dissect the biomechanics of a sprinter's start or a pitcher's wind-up with scientific precision. By comparing an athlete's motion against an ideal model, subtle inefficiencies are identified and corrected. This leads to optimized energy expenditure, improved speed, and enhanced power output. The data serves as a digital coach, offering feedback that is both immediate and quantifiable, pushing the boundaries of human performance.

Integration with Modern Technology

The versatility of ultra pose skeleton allows for seamless integration into existing technological ecosystems. It is a fundamental component in the development of augmented reality (AR) filters, where virtual objects must interact naturally with human movement. Furthermore, it powers the next generation of video conferencing tools, enabling accurate gesture control and virtual background replacement. This adaptability ensures that as new platforms emerge, the skeleton tracking technology remains relevant and embedded within the fabric of our digital lives.

Privacy and Ethical Considerations

As with any technology that analyzes human presence, the use of ultra pose skeleton raises important questions regarding privacy and data security. The detailed nature of the data captured means that developers and businesses must prioritize ethical implementation. Ensuring that data is processed locally on the device, rather than in the cloud, can mitigate privacy risks. Transparent policies regarding data collection and user consent are essential to build trust and ensure this powerful technology is used responsibly to augment human capability without compromising individual rights.
